The Kistler Aerospace K-1 reusable launch vehicle is a complete system designed for the launch of commercial satellites to low earth orbit. The Kistler engineering team has been busy designing and building the fleet of five K-1 launch vehicles since mid- 1996. Development is on schedule to support flights tests in Fall 1998 and operational missions in 1999.
